Belinda frowned at Kristopher’s words. “Kristopher, have you not been home for days?”
He seemed oblivious to her desire for a divorce, still assuming she orbited his world.
Kristopher’s smirk turned icy. “So, because I haven’t been home, you chased me all the way to Rozand to crash this party?” His frosty tone sent a chill through Belinda’s heart.
She knew she had guessed correctly.
A week after her miscarriage, her legal husband had yet to return home, unaware she had left him with a divorce agreement.
Despite her diminished expectations for Kristopher, his absurd remarks still cut deep.
What had made her so unyieldingly stubborn before?
Why had she believed her devotion could touch a man who never even gave her a second look?
